Message type: E = Error
Message class: STC_CONT_CFG_ENTITY - Technical Configuration Entity Messages
Message number: 248
Message text: Select at least one content row

- Select at least one content row ?The SAP error message STC_CONT_CFG_ENTITY248, which states "Select at least one content row," typically occurs in the context of the SAP Solution Manager or during the configuration of certain content entities. This error indicates that the system expects at least one content row to be selected for processing, but none has been selected.
Cause:
- No Selection Made: The most straightforward cause is that the user has not selected any rows in the content table or list where the action is being performed.
- Filter Settings: Sometimes, filters applied to the content list may hide all available rows, leading to the impression that there are no selectable items.
- User Permissions: The user may not have the necessary permissions to view or select the content rows.
- Technical Issues: There could be a temporary glitch or issue with the SAP system that is preventing the selection of content rows.
Solution:
- Select Content Rows: Ensure that you select at least one row in the content list before proceeding with the action that triggered the error.
- Check Filters: Review any filters that may be applied to the content list. Clear or adjust filters to ensure that relevant rows are visible and selectable.
- User Permissions: Verify that you have the appropriate permissions to access and select the content rows. If not, contact your system administrator to adjust your permissions.
- Refresh the Screen: Sometimes, simply refreshing the screen or logging out and back into the system can resolve temporary glitches.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ance related to the content entity you are working with.
